ICES is a Brussels-based think tank seeking to foster better mutual understanding
between China and Europe by supporting academic research in a broad range of fields,
including but not limited to business and trade, international law, ocean management,
and global governance. Since we are funded by Hainan, our mission includes promoting
regional developments and advancing our focus on maritime affairs.
To achieve its objectives, ICES is organising academic events and exhibitions,
publishing research papers and reports, as well as supporting academic exchanges, to
promote the free flow of ideas and people between Europe and China.
The ICES is supported by a full-time team in its Brussels office and also seeks to develop relationships with non-resident research fellows. Our research focuses on economic and trade relations, global governance, ocean management as well as other issues central to the China-EU relationship.
